Transfer | Fall Orientation Transfer Orientation Options

Orientation & Family Programs offers Transfer Students two types of orientation programs: an on-campus or an online orientation experience. Transfer Roundup for students with 30 or more college credit hours is optional, but attendance is strongly encouraged.

On-Campus Orientation

Transfer Roundup – Spirit, Pride & Tradition:

  • Held at the Main Campus
  • One-Day Program – 8:30 a.m. – 5:30 p.m.
  • Designed to introduce new transfer students to academic policies and student services unique to UTSA and introduce them to the UTSA community
    • Receive a tour of the campus
    • Meet with faculty and staff
    • Take care of university business
    • Receive an individual appointment with an academic advisor, to prepare for course registration

Online Orientation

Transfer students can complete an online orientation experience at their own pace and convenience. The online orientation is filled with valuable information about UTSA services, resources, academic policies and much more!

Please note: online orientation does not include a meeting with your academic advisor or assistance with course registration.
